学校客户端无服务器提交MapReduce任务时长时间无响应问题解析
在学校环境中,当使用无服务器架构提交MapReduce任务时,客户端长时间无响应的问题可能由多种原因引起,MapReduce是一种用于处理大量数据的编程模型,它通过“映射”和“归约”两个阶段来并行处理数据,在无服务器架构中,没有固定的服务器资源,而是根据需求动态地分配计算资源,这种架构可能会遇到一些特定的挑战。
可能的原因及解决方案
1. 网络延迟
原因:
网络不稳定或带宽不足可能导致数据传输缓慢,从而影响任务的提交和执行。
解决方案:
确保网络连接稳定,并检查网络带宽是否满足需求。
尝试在不同的时间段提交任务,以避开网络高峰。
2. 资源分配问题
原因:
在无服务器架构中,资源是按需分配的,如果资源分配不及时或不足,可能会导致任务无法及时开始执行。
解决方案:
监控资源分配情况,确保有足够的资源来处理提交的任务。
调整资源分配策略,以便更快地响应任务需求。
3. 客户端配置错误
原因:
客户端配置不当可能导致与无服务器平台的通信不畅。
解决方案:
检查客户端配置,确保所有设置都正确无误。
参考官方文档或联系技术支持以获取正确的配置指南。
4. MapReduce作业配置问题
原因:
MapReduce作业的配置错误可能导致任务无法正确执行。
解决方案:
仔细检查MapReduce作业的配置文件,确保所有参数设置正确。
参考MapReduce框架的文档,了解如何正确配置作业。
5. 系统故障或维护
原因:
无服务器平台可能因为系统故障或维护而导致服务不可用。
解决方案:
查看平台的系统状态页面或联系技术支持,了解是否有已知的服务中断。
如果可能,等待系统恢复后再尝试提交任务。
相关问题与解答
Q1: 如果客户端长时间无响应,我应该如何诊断问题所在?
A1: 你可以通过以下步骤进行诊断:
1、检查网络连接是否正常,包括网络稳定性和带宽。
2、确认无服务器平台的状态,排除系统故障或维护的可能性。
3、验证客户端配置是否正确,包括认证信息、API端点等。
4、查看MapReduce作业的日志文件,寻找可能的错误信息或警告。
5、如果以上步骤都无法解决问题,考虑联系技术支持获取帮助。
Q2: 提交MapReduce任务时,有哪些最佳实践可以避免长时间无响应的问题?
A2: 以下是一些最佳实践:
1、确保网络环境稳定,避免在网络高峰期提交任务。
2、优化MapReduce作业的配置,确保资源分配合理。
3、定期检查和更新客户端配置,以适应平台的变化。
4、监控无服务器平台的资源使用情况,及时调整资源分配策略。
5、熟悉MapReduce框架的文档和社区资源,以便快速定位和解决问题。
以上就是关于“学校客户端无服务器_提交MapReduce任务时客户端长时间无响应”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1116356.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复